PROMOT: modular modeling for systems biology
Sebastian Mirschel1, Katrin Steinmetz, Michael Rempel
1Systems Biology Group, Max Planck Institute for Dynamics of Complex Technical Systems, 39106 Magdeburg, Germany. mirschel@mpi-magdeburg.mpg.de
Summary:
The modeling tool PROMOT facilitates the efficient and comprehensible setup and editing of modular models coupled with customizable visual representations. Since its last major publication in 2003, PROMOT has gained new functionality in particular support of logical models, efficient editing, visual exploration, model validation and support for SBML.
Availability:
PROMOT is an open source project and freely available at http://www.mpi-magdeburg.mpg.de/projects/promot/.
